The installation of portable restrooms must be approached with meticulous planning and execution. Key considerations include selecting appropriate locations that are easily accessible yet discreet enough to respect users' privacy. The site should ideally be level and firm to prevent tipping or instability, which could lead to accidents or spillage. It’s also important to ensure proximity to handwashing stations if they are not integrated into the units themselves. This supports good hygiene practices by facilitating handwashing after use.
Moreover, strategic placement can enhance user experience while minimizing environmental impact. For instance, restrooms should be positioned away from food service areas and natural water sources to prevent contamination risks. Compliance with local regulations regarding sanitation distances and waste management is crucial during installation planning.
Once installed, the focus shifts to diligent maintenance practices. Regular cleaning schedules must be established based on usage intensity; high-traffic areas demand more frequent servicing than those with sporadic use. Cleaning involves thorough disinfection of all surfaces within the unit — from doors and handles to toilet seats and floors — using approved sanitizing agents that effectively kill germs without posing harm to users or the environment.
Additionally, routine inspections are essential for identifying any structural issues such as leaks or damage that could compromise functionality or hygiene standards. Prompt repair work ensures that minor problems do not escalate into major health hazards.
Waste disposal forms another critical aspect of maintenance best practices. Portable restroom providers should engage qualified waste management services that comply with environmental regulations for safe disposal methods. This reduces potential pollution risks associated with improper handling of human waste.
Finally, effective communication between facility managers and service providers can optimize both installation outcomes and ongoing maintenance efforts. Clear agreements regarding responsibility for upkeep tasks help avoid lapses that might lead to deteriorating conditions over time.

One notable example is the city of San Francisco, which faced a growing challenge with sanitation due to its increasing homeless population and bustling tourism industry. By strategically placing portable restrooms throughout key areas of the city, local authorities were able to address both hygiene concerns and improve overall public welfare. The project not only provided essential facilities for those in need but also significantly reduced instances of public urination and defecation, contributing to a cleaner urban environment.
Similarly, Glastonbury Festival in England serves as an exemplary model of how large-scale events can benefit from portable restroom installations. With hundreds of thousands attending annually, the festival organizers prioritized health compliance by deploying eco-friendly composting toilets throughout the venue. These units not only managed waste efficiently but also minimized environmental impact by converting human waste into usable compost material. The success at Glastonbury showcases how innovative restroom solutions can align with sustainability goals while ensuring attendee comfort and satisfaction.
Another compelling case comes from Tokyo's Shibuya district, where pop-up night markets and street festivals attract vast numbers of visitors. In response to this influx, city planners implemented mobile restroom units equipped with advanced sanitation technology such as touchless fixtures and solar-powered lighting. These state-of-the-art facilities have been instrumental in managing waste effectively while maintaining high standards of hygiene amidst dense crowds.
Moreover, during natural disasters or emergencies where traditional infrastructure might be compromised, portable restrooms have proven indispensable. For instance, following Hurricane Katrina in 2005, temporary restroom facilities played a crucial role in relief efforts across affected regions along the Gulf Coast. The quick deployment ensured access to basic sanitation needs for displaced residents and emergency responders alike, preventing potential outbreaks of disease caused by inadequate waste management.
